Property rentals up 50 per cent

In the last year, property rentals in the UK have increased by almost 50 per cent according to the second largest lettings agent Your Move.

Their figures show that the number of leases commencing in September rose 4.34% from the previous month, and rose 45% in the nine months previous compared with the same period the year before.

Tighter lending conditions and the fall in property valuations have been cited as major reasons why buyers have been deterred from entering onto the property ladder and have looked at renting.

Your Move’s David Newnes said: “As banks put a stopper in the bottle of mortgage finance, potential buyers have to stay in rented homes for longer than they have in the past.

“The lettings market is thriving across the UK – we are seeing the strongest tenant demand we’ve ever had, far beyond normal seasonal fluctuations.”
